EBIT, sometimes also called Earnings Before Interest and Taxes, is a measure of a firm's profit that includes all expenses except interest and income tax expenses. It is the difference between operating revenues and operating expenses. When a firm does not have non-operating income, then Operating Income is sometimes used as a synonym for EBIT and operating profit.

DreamArts Business Description

Address Ebisu Garden Place Tower 29th Floor, 4-20-3 Ebisu, Shibuya-ku, Tokyo, JPN
DreamArts Corp is engaged in the development of computer systems and business software. The company also provides SaaS products, such as the no-code development tool SmartDB, and consulting services for business digitalization, mainly targeting the enterprise market. The Group operates through three business segments: the Cloud Business, which offers products including SmartDB, InsuiteX, Shop Ran, and DCR DX Custom Resolution; the On-premise Business, which provides SmartDB Installable; and the Professional Services Business.
